Celery aids in lowering blood pressure and improvement of overall health


Celery aids in lowering blood pressure and improvement of overall health Celery has proven to aid in lowering blood pressure and the improvement of overall health

Celery’s potential for lowing high blood pressure has long been recognised by Chinese medicine practitioners, and recent research has identified why. Celery contains a high level of calcium, magnesium, potassium and active compounds called phthalides, which have been found to lower blood pressure and promote a healthy circulatory system. Celery is best eaten raw; however the juice is also especially useful for overall good health.

Other Health Benefits

According to a recent study published in Cancer Prevention Research, the compound called apigenin, found in celery, has the potential to reduce the risk of cancer as it has anti-tumour activity and can prevent certain breast cancer tumour cells from multiplying and growing.
Celery is an excellent source of vitamin C which helps support your immune system and may aid in reducing cold symptoms. Vitamin C also aids in the prevention of free radical damage that triggers the inflammatory cascade, which means celery is also associated with reducing the severity of inflammatory conditions such as asthma, rheumatoid arthritis and osteoarthritis. Vitamin C also promotes improved cardiovascular health.
Celery contains compounds called coumarins that help prevent free radicals from damaging cells, thus decreasing the mutations that increase the potential for cells to become cancerous. Coumarins also enhance the activity of certain white blood cells, immune defenders that target and eliminate potentially harmful cells, including cancer cells. In addition, compounds in celery called acetylenics have been shown to stop the growth of tumor cells.

Preparing Celery

To aid in reducing high blood pressure, celery is best eaten raw and whole celery and also acts as a tonic for the liver.

Drinking a glass of celery juice before a meal is said to act as a natural appetite suppressant for those wanting to lose weight.

Although best eaten raw for optimum health benefits, celery is also useful and tasty when added to salads, soups, stews and a variety of other delicious dishes. Experiment with combinations of celery and/or onions, green peppers, garlic, chili powder, tomatoes, parsley, barley, carrots and coriander for a yummy hearty soup.

Celery is also great as a cooked, sautéed vegetable. Celery prepared in this way will retain most of the potassium, and stays crunchy. Since celery is high in sodium, it is unnecessary to add salt when this vegetable is part of a dish.
